Can I use Wilton red gel to paint on gumpaste? Will it be red enough if I paint it on? I need to make a bobber for a retirement cake and that's the last little detail. The cake is being delivered tomorrow. TIA

I would be concerned that the gel would be too thick, and turn sticky if painted on the gumpaste....I am thinking you may have to thin it with a small amount of vanilla extract if you don't have vodka....I would mix it, then test a bit of it on some other gumpaste to see if it's red enough....

For future projects, get some powdered coloring. You can mix it with alcohol or confectioners glaze for full strength color. You can also mix it with cocoa butter for painting on chocolate.
